dc.descriptionPer Board of Regents' policy, within the University System of Georgia a President may accept or deny any act of any council or committee of his or her institution. Presidents must put their decisions, including reasons in the event of a denial, in writing and transmit them to the proper officer. Copies of any deny statements are also submitted to the Chancellor. At the University of West Georgia, the primary body of the faculty is the Faculty Senate, to which Senators are elected by their respective schools or departments. UWG Presidents ratify or deny the decisions of the Faculty Senate after the minutes of the meeting are approved, which is typically at the Senate's subsequent meeting.
